On Wednesday night I attended the Seven New York launch of 6 designer fragrance at the New Museum. The fete was hosted by Brit fashion designer Gareth Pugh with music by the MisShapes. Terence Koh also showed his new paintings at Richard Avedon's Upper East Side townhouse, which is now owned by Nicolas Sarkozy's half-brother, Olivier Sarkozy. It was certainly a night to remember.
